PBS Youth chief Christopher Mandut challenges the notion that the 'Sabah for Sabahans' and 'Sarawak for Sarawakians' slogans are unhealthy. FMTNews

KOTA KINABALU: Parti Bersatu Sabah has defended the use of the “Sabah for Sabahans” and “Sarawak for Sarawakians” slogans following criticism from the prime minister who recently questioned the effect of such mentalities on national unity.

“It’s about our rights, and if the federal government had been paying attention, it would have understood why.” He gave the upcoming Malaysia Day as an example, saying it was only gazetted by executive order instead of being brought to Parliament and inserted in Article 160 of the Federal Constitution.“Our fellow Malaysians in Malaya are too busy talking about race and religion,” he added.
